Transaction 89f603808e083a79210fb20d69658a9498e912010ee4577b5ad2b14d30dce363
1 Input
1 Output
-
89f603808e083a79210fb20d69658a9498e912010ee4577b5ad2b14d30dce363:0
- value
- 58717
- script pubkey
- OP_0 OP_PUSHBYTES_20 424bde26a1786af08b22d91cc506a5ee8c580c5a
- address
- bc1qgf9auf4p0p40pzezmywv2p49a6x9srz6laxxae